It never ceases to amaze me the number of people out there who think every draft year is the same and there are just always a good crop of players in every draft at every position.

Nothing could be further from the truth, but there remains, it would seem, a majority of fans who want to just generalize everything, like it was a video game or something.

Wake the effin hail up!!

There aren't elite players at every position in every draft year.

This is one of the worst QB classes ever. If you need a backup QB, draft one in the mid rounds. Easton Stick might be one of the best #2 candidates ever. He fits a #2 role perfectly.

This year is top heavy in defensive lineman. A good year to draft a DL in the first or second round.

This year is devoid of OL talent in the first two rounds. A good year to be patient and draft OL in the 3rd-6th round.

This year is devoid of top tier CB talent period. Wait until next year, or at least until the later rounds on some of the small school developmental projects.

This year is loaded with slot receiver talent from top to bottom. Lucky you, if are in need at that position,Dolphins aren't.
